## Further Reading

The WavePeek preview renderer downsamples audio to 400 buckets before drawing. Covered at last sync: peak-vs-RMS modes, the Quillbrook caching quirk, and why mono mixdown happens client-side. Don't re-read the old spec; it's stale. The current design notes and open questions live on the internal page here.

wiki page, bagaf-fawip: https://harbor.tolvaqsys.local/pages/repo/pages/secrets/eac969ffc71f356b

**Ticket: Crash reports dropped after symbolication**

The Wrenlet mobile crash pipeline is discarding ~15% of reports when symbolication times out. Retry queue never picks them up. Repro: upload a report with a missing dsym mapping. Fix should requeue instead of dropping. Verify against the staging build identified by the token below.

pipeline stamp: htk9_ce63042d9

**Q: Can my plugin supply custom word lists to GridGnome?**

Yep! GridGnome accepts any UTF-8 word list via the `lexicon` hook, and the generator will weight your entries alongside the default dictionary. Just watch out for duplicate scoring keys — they'll silently override ours. Full hook reference and scoring quirks live on the internal page below.

runbook for badug-kadup: https://confluence.zemvarlabs.internal/projects/browse/display/projects/bd1b

## 3.8.1 — Key rotation

Fabrikit (test-data factory lib) rotated its package-signing key after the old one hit its 12-month expiry. No API changes. Action for on-call: builds pulling Fabrikit will fail verification until the new public key lands in the trust store; the Quillmont pipeline pushes it automatically, everyone else updates manually. Old key is revoked as of this release. New signing key follows.

deploy key for kajof-fajop: bky6_gDHw9Q